劈头盖脸 in English pi1 tou2 gai4 lian3 Meaning

Meanings

  • literally (word for word) splitting the head and covering the face (idiomatic expression); metaphorically pelting (with rain and so on)
  • showering down

Simplified Characters

Traditional Characters

Pinyin

pi1 tou2 gai4 lian3

Literal

Literal explanation, with pronunciation and meaning of each character.

pi1to hack tou2head gai4surname Ge lian3face